Buy Targeted traffic
Categories
Ads

Buy Traffic Leads Leap

Buy Traffic Leads Leap is an online advertising service that specializes in providing targeted website traffic to businesses and organizations. It offers a unique and effective solution for those looking to increase their online visibility and reach a wider audience. In today's digital age, where…